Babylonish

English dictionary entry

Meanings

adj
  1. Of or pertaining to, or made in, Babylon or Babylonia.
  2. Pertaining to the Babylon of Revelation xiv. 8.
  3. Pertaining to Rome and papal power.
  4. Confused; Babel-like.

Etymology

From Babylon + -ish. Compare Old English Babilōnisċ. Piecewise doublet of Babelish.
